NL27WZ126
Dual Buffer with 3-State
Outputs
The NL27WZ126 is a high performance dual noninverting buffer
operating from a 1.65 V to 5.5 V supply.
Features
⢠Extremely High Speed: tPD 2.6 ns (typical) at VCC = 5.0 V
⢠Designed for 1.65 V to 5.5 V VCC Operation
⢠Over Voltage Tolerant Inputs and Outputs
⢠LVTTL Compatible â Interface Capability With 5.0 V TTL Logic
with VCC = 3.0 V
⢠LVCMOS Compatible
⢠24 mA Balanced Output Sink and Source Capability
⢠Near Zero Static Supply Current Substantially Reduces System
Power Requirements
⢠3âState OE Input is ActiveâHigh
⢠Replacement for NC7WZ126
⢠Chip Complexity = 72 FETs
⢠These Devices are PbâFree and are RoHS Compliant
